Regarding: The group called
" The Veterans Support Organization
"


Statement of Richard DiFederico,
Past State Commander of the Veterans of Foreign Wars, Department of Connecticut.


As a Past State Commander of the Veterans of Foreign Wars in Connecticut, I and all of the over 25,000 members of the VFW' s and our auxiliaries are appalled at the tactics of the group calling themselves, " The Veterans Support Organization" Their callous and despicable actions concerning the illegitimate fund raising campaign they have done here in Connecticut and around the country only dilutes the help for our Veterans that our citizens so freely donate to, thinking the money will be used to aid Connecticut's Veterans, when in fact very little, if any at all, is used for the Veterans here in our state. That they dress in military uniforms to portray themselves as Veterans, when many of them are not, further shows that they are nothing but a bunch of scam artists. The Citizens of Connecticut should be cautious as to whom they donate their hard earned money to, and not simply because someone slaps on a military uniform and puts their hand out for a donation in the name of a good cause. Vultures the likes of them should be dealt with in the harshest of legal terms as is possible. I am proud that my organization, the VFW has introduced a bill in our Statehouse to eliminate such scam artists as them in our state. Please view the Fox video below.

Richard Difederico, Past State Commander

POPPIES
BUDDY POPPY: It is clear that the assembly portion of the Buddy Poppy Program has experienced some difficult transitions and those continue. Changes in VA rules regarding assemblers, declining production from aging facilities (assemblers), and slow start-up of new facilities has resulted in a struggle to fulfill orders. Although new facilities are being brought on line and procedural changes are starting to improve the situation, we again ask for your patience as we get back to acceptable levels. As we have reviewed the problems, we have discovered two areas that you can help us with. First, when you place an order, please provide a specific and reasonable delivery date. The majority of your orders simply says, "ASAP" or leaves the delivery date box empty. In those cases, we have no choice but to process them in the order they are received. If you provide a specific date, we will endeavor to meet that deadline.

However, please order your poppies a minimum of 8-12 weeks ahead of when you need them.
